  • The Importance Of Cryo Sample Storage

    Cryo sample storage plays a crucial role in the preservation and longevity of samples in various industries, such as healthcare, biotechnology, and research. The cryogenic storage of biological materials at ultra-low temperatures ensures that samples remain viable for future analysis and experimentation. This storage method involves placing samples in specialized containers, such as cryogenic vials or tubes, and storing them in ultra-cold environments, typically at temperatures below -130°C. The cryo sample storage not only maintains the integrity of the samples but also protects them from degradation and contamination, allowing researchers to conduct reliable and reproducible experiments.

    The cryo sample storage is particularly important in healthcare and biotechnology industries, where the viability of biological samples, such as tissues, cells, and genetic materials, is critical for various applications, including diagnostic testing, drug discovery, and personalized medicine. By preserving samples in cryogenic conditions, researchers can ensure that they have access to high-quality materials for their studies and experiments.

    One of the key advantages of cryo sample storage is the long-term preservation of samples. Unlike conventional storage methods, such as refrigeration or freezer storage, cryogenic storage at ultra-low temperatures ensures that samples remain viable for extended periods, ranging from months to decades. This is particularly beneficial for long-term research studies, clinical trials, and biobanking initiatives, where the availability of high-quality samples is essential for the success of the project.

    In addition to long-term preservation, cryo sample storage also offers protection against contamination and degradation. The ultra-cold temperatures prevent microbial growth and enzymatic activity, which can compromise the integrity of the samples. By storing samples in cryogenic conditions, researchers can minimize the risk of contamination and ensure that their samples maintain their original properties and characteristics over time. This is especially important for sensitive biological materials, such as stem cells, tissues, and DNA, where even minor changes can have a significant impact on the results of the experiments.

  • Maximizing Safety And Efficiency With Laminar Flow Biological Safety Cabinets

    In the world of laboratory research and experimentation, maintaining a safe work environment is paramount. One of the key tools used to ensure safety in laboratory settings is the laminar flow biological safety cabinet, commonly referred to as a biosafety cabinet. These cabinets are designed to provide a highly controlled environment for handling infectious materials and other biohazardous substances, minimizing the risk of exposure to researchers and ensuring the integrity of sensitive experiments.

    A laminar flow biological safety cabinet works by creating a flow of filtered air that moves in a constant, unidirectional stream. This airflow helps to remove any contaminants present in the air, protecting both the materials within the cabinet and the researchers working with them. The cabinet is equipped with a HEPA filter that traps particles as small as 0.3 microns, ensuring that the air inside the cabinet remains clean and free of harmful agents.

    There are three main classes of biological safety cabinets, with the laminar flow cabinet falling under Class II. Class II biosafety cabinets are further divided into Types A1, A2, B1, and B2, each offering varying levels of protection depending on the specific requirements of the laboratory. laminar flow biological safety cabinets, which fall under Type A2, provide personnel, environmental, and product protection by maintaining a continuous flow of filtered air over the work surface, ensuring a sterile working environment for researchers.

    The design of a biological cabinet is crucial to its effectiveness in providing a safe working environment. A typical cabinet consists of a work surface, a transparent front panel, and a series of filters and ventilation systems. The work surface is usually made of stainless steel or other non-porous material that can be easily cleaned and disinfected. The front panel is made of tempered glass or acrylic that allows the user to see inside the cabinet while providing a barrier against harmful particles.

    The most important feature of a biological cabinet is the high-efficiency particulate air (HEPA) filter. This filter removes 99.97% of particles larger than 0.3 microns in size, including bacteria, viruses, and other contaminants. The HEPA filter is located at the back of the cabinet and is connected to a ventilation system that circulates air through the cabinet, ensuring a constant flow of clean, filtered air.

  • Unlocking The Potential Of Biopharmaceutical Solutions

    biopharmaceutical solutions have revolutionized the field of medicine by offering innovative treatments and therapies for a wide range of diseases and conditions. These solutions utilize biological processes and materials to develop advanced drugs and therapies that target specific molecular pathways in the body. With their ability to address complex diseases, such as cancer, autoimmune disorders, and rare genetic conditions, biopharmaceutical solutions have become a key player in the healthcare industry.

    One of the main advantages of biopharmaceutical solutions is their targeted approach to treatment. Unlike traditional pharmaceuticals, which often have non-specific effects on the body, biopharmaceuticals are designed to interact with specific molecules or pathways involved in the disease process. This targeted approach not only increases the effectiveness of the treatment but also reduces the risk of side effects and adverse reactions.

    Another key benefit of biopharmaceutical solutions is their ability to treat diseases that were previously considered untreatable. For example, biologics, a class of biopharmaceutical drugs made from living organisms, have revolutionized the treatment of autoimmune diseases such as rheumatoid arthritis, psoriasis, and Crohn’s disease. These drugs target the underlying mechanisms of the disease, providing long-lasting relief for patients who may have otherwise struggled to find effective treatment options.

    In addition to targeted therapies, biopharmaceutical solutions also offer personalized medicine options. By utilizing genetic testing and molecular profiling, healthcare providers can tailor treatments to the individual patient’s unique genetic makeup. This personalized approach not only increases the likelihood of success but also minimizes the risk of adverse reactions, as the treatment is specifically tailored to the patient’s genetic profile.

    Furthermore, biopharmaceutical solutions have shown great promise in the field of oncology. With the development of antibody-drug conjugates and immunotherapies, researchers have made significant strides in treating various types of cancer. These therapies target cancer cells while sparing healthy cells, reducing the toxic side effects often associated with traditional chemotherapy. Additionally, immunotherapies harness the body’s own immune system to attack cancer cells, offering a more targeted and effective approach to cancer treatment.

    One of the challenges facing the biopharmaceutical industry is the high cost of development and production. Biopharmaceutical drugs are complex to manufacture and require specialized facilities and equipment, leading to higher production costs compared to traditional pharmaceuticals. Additionally, the regulatory process for approving biopharmaceutical drugs can be lengthy and costly, further adding to the overall cost of bringing these innovative therapies to market.

  • The Magic Of Acid-Etching: A Guide To Creating Beautiful Designs

    acid-etching, also known as chemical milling, is a process that involves using acid to create intricate designs on various surfaces, including metal, glass, and ceramics. This technique has been used for centuries to add intricate patterns and textures to objects, and it continues to be a popular method for artists and craftsmen looking to add a touch of elegance to their work.

    The process of acid-etching involves applying a resist material, such as wax or a special acid-resistant film, to the surface of the object. The design is then drawn or transferred onto the resist material, and the exposed areas are etched away using an acid solution. The acid reacts with the surface of the object, creating a frosted appearance in the etched areas while leaving the resist material intact.
